15TITLE           Helix
16
17OCCURRENCE      ARB_EDIT4/Edit/Reload Helix
18
19DESCRIPTION     The 'SAI' (see LINK{glossary.hlp}) entry 'HELIX_NR' contains
20                numbering of potential higher order structure elements. The
21                paired 5' and 3' helix halves are indicated by identical
22                numbers. The SAI entry 'HELIX' contains symbols ([<( and )>])
23                indicating positions which usually are base paired. This
24                information is used by the editor to check the sequences for
25                (correct) base pairing. User-defined symbols indicating base pairing and
26                mispairing are shown below the particular sequences.

29SECTION FORMAT OF HELIX/HELIX_NR:
30
31                When the 'HELIX/HELIX_NR SAI's are analyzed the following steps
32                are performed:
33
34                1. HELIX_NR contains the helix numbering. A helix number
35                   is a number between 0 and 100 optionally followed
36                   by one letter: e.g. 11a, 23g, 0i, 6, 23,
37
38                   A helix number is valid from the position of the
39                   first digit to the position just before the next
40                   helix number.
41
42                        eg.     .........1a.........23b.........
43                        .       .........|||||||||||............
44
45                   The '|' symbols indicate the positions for '1a'
46
47                2. All '<[{(' symbols in HELIX are replaced by '('
48                   All '>]})' symbols in HELIX are replaced by ')'
49
50                        eg.     ...[<<[..]>>].. is the same as ...((((..))))..
51
52                3. For each helix number 'HN' a temporary helix is created
53                   that contains all '()' symbols of the 'SAI HELIX' at
54                   all positions where 'HN' is valid.
55
56                        eg. HELIX_NR    .....1a.....23b.......1a....23b.....
57                            HELIX       .....[<<[...[<[.......]>>]..]>].....
58                            -> 1a       .....((((.............))))..........
59                            -> 23b      ............(((.............))).....
60
61                4.      The (usually) paired positions can simply be defined
62                        by recursively removing the innermost bracket pairs
63                        in the temporary helices:
64
65                        eg. HELIX_NR    .....1a.....23b.......1a....23b.....
66                                HELIX   .....[<<[...[<[.......]>>]..]>].....
67                                Pos     123456789012345678901234567890123456
68                                -> 1a   .....((((.............))))..........
69                                -> 23b  ............(((.............))).....
70                                1a 9-23 ........+-------------+.............
71                                1a 8-24 .......+---------------+............
72                                1a 7-25 ......+-----------------+...........
73                                1a 6-26 .....+-------------------+..........
74                                23b 15-29 .............+------------+.......
75                                23b 14-30 ............+--------------+......
76                                23b 13-31 ...........+----------------+.....
77
78NOTES           After inserting or deleting gaps in the whole alignment (ARB_NT/
79                Sequence/Insert delete columns) the helix information has to be:
80
81                        1. Checked (inserting a '.' between '1' and '2'
82                           destroys the original '12').
83
84                        2. reloaded using 'Reload Helix'
85
